Burj Khalifa rose from the Dubai desert in 2010 as an 828-meter sapphire shard — the world's tallest structure, designed by SOM's Adrian Smith on a tripartite Y-plan abstracted from the Hymenocallis flower. Its curtain wall reads cobalt-to-steel at dusk while the Dubai Fountain throws aged-gold LED light across the lake below.

This design system captures the view from the observation deck at blue hour: deep sapphire glass, steel-blue sky, jet-black night, and gold refractions. Typography pairs luxury serif display with clean software-product body text, and every surface carries the precision of parametric engineering.
